Released , 'Hemingway vs. Callaghan' stars Vincent Walsh, Robin Dunne, Gordon Pinsent, Michael Ironside The movie has a runtime of about 2 hr 50 min, and received a user score of (out of 100) on TMDb, which put together reviews from experienced users.

Want to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"'Hemingway vs. Callaghan' is based on the true story of the friendship between Ernest Hemingway and Morley Callaghan in Toronto and Paris between 1923 and 1929." .
